Farm in the City can considered as Malaysian village-themed petting zoo, is an unique concept that combines the element of wildlife and natural set in a designed environment of a conservation park. Here we are allowed to touch (yes, we can really.. really.. touch), feed and play with the animals.

Farm in the City located in Seri Kembangan, Selangor. Opening times is 10.00am to 6.00pm daily. 9.30am to 6.00pm on weekends. Closed on Tuesday. The price of ticket is RM30 for adults and RM25 for children below 12. Children below 90cm in height will enjoy free entrance.
